Subject: [PATCH next] ACPICA: AML Parser: Remove spurious precision from format used to dump parse trees

The debug code in acpi_ps_delete_parse_tree() uses ("%*.s", level * 4, " ")
to indent traces.
POSIX requires the empty precision be treated as zero, but the kernel treats
is as 'no precision specified'.
Change to ("%*s", level * 4, "") since there is additional whitespace and no
reason to indent by one space when level is zero.

diff --git a/drivers/acpi/acpica/pswalk.c b/drivers/acpi/acpica/pswalk.c
index 2f3ebcd8aebe..b1ec75e277ab 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/acpica/pswalk.c
+++ b/drivers/acpi/acpica/pswalk.c
@@ -49,8 +49,7 @@ void acpi_ps_delete_parse_tree(union acpi_parse_object *subtree_root)
/* This debug option will print the entire parse tree */
- acpi_os_printf(" %*.s%s %p", (level * 4),
- " ",
+ acpi_os_printf(" %*s%s %p", (level * 4), "",
acpi_ps_get_opcode_name(op->
common.
aml_opcode),
